The Brother Innov-is CS 8060 was my first sewing machine. I still works and I am very happy that I had to learn on exactly that machine as it is quite user friendly.
The things that I don't like are that after four years (only two of which more intense work) it needs reparation. When there is little left from the bobbin it makes a great mess with the upper thread. I have to check whether the stitch on the back is proper as it makes "birds nests" with no reason more and more often.
The bobbin winder doesn't wind more than one bobbin which is because something in the Brother Innov-is CS 8060 machine needs change (I find that quite embarrassing as I like to wind 4-5 bobbins ahead) and it hasn't been used that much.
I find the automatic threader inefficient - sometimes it takes me 10-20 tries to thread automatically and at the same time there's no MANUAL threading option.
I am not mentioning some of the embroidery stitches that didn't function from the very beginning.
All those years I thought that the problem was in my not-knowing but it turned out that the problem was not in me, unfortunately now that I realized that the guarantee period is over, but I'm not willing to invest more in that machine.
